I’m glad I tried, but it feels very long. Also the multiple interruptions to drool over Xaden were getting grating. I think the author could have benefitted from just describing Xaden’s attractive points in a good way instead of just having Violet straight up tell us “HES SO HOT GUYS I’m down bad 🥵🥵🥵”

The main two  can’t communicate for shit. Sure she got together with the “leader of a revolution” or whatever but you’re in a serious relationship. Be for real. Violet is understandably feeling very insecure bc everything she knows is turning out to be fake (her image of the world, her brother’s death), she’s annoying but I kinda see why LOL. 

The other thing is that the side characters still feel p flat. Most of what they say and do exists to prop Violet up in the eyes of the reader, very transparently. They don’t seem to have much going on in their lives even tho they’re in the same school. I think the only character I really got attached to was Jesinia. 

There’s also a lot fo focus on anyone except the protagonists literal formerly dead brother from book one 💀💀💀 he’s been as relevant and explored as a potted plant,,, it’s annoying the hell outta me that we haven’t fleshed him out AT ALL 9 hours into the book. He’s been built up a good amount in book 1.

Anyways I might come back to this but I think I’ll be fine just reading a synopsis.

What a trip this book was…first and foremost: I didn’t love it as much as the first one but it’s still an amazing book nonetheless. Most annoying was def the interactions and the drama between Violet and Xaden…most if the time I didn’t even understand why she was mad or what her point was and it seemed as though she didn’t either. The whole „ask me“-thing annoyed me as hell! Like just tell her ?! Why make a „game“ out of it? I often also felt that the author made the reader miss out on a lot of their interactions and I felt like I missed out on much of the two of them together. This book was much more focused on Violet and her development as a character and a rider as well as her relationship with her friends, which I did like but I just wish there was also more Xaden in it. The fact that we only got one decent sex scene kinda disappointed me tbh but that’s just personal preference hahah. One thing I especially liked was Andarnas development and sassiness! I felt like she wasn’t as important in the first book but in this book she def was! And I love her so much! In conclusion I suppose we can all agree that the ending was heartbreaking and it def made me tear up but I don’t think all hope is lost. I‘m sure Violet will find some way as she always does.
